I have a 2002 patrol with a 2006 motor , I have just fitted a 3 inch exhaust and blocked the emmission ,
I have a boost and egt guage fitted .
I now need to adjust the turbo and was wondering if there is anywhere in perth , (northern suburbs if poss ) that can do this .
also ,should I fit a dawes valve and manual boost control .

If you are fitting a Dawes and needle valve you wont need to make any other adjustments.
But if you are going without the above mentioned you will need to adjust your VNT adjustment back 1/2 a turn to compensate for your new zorst and egr block.{to stop your turbo spooling up too quick}.
